Al ‘Idwah weather in October

In October, Al ‘Idwah sees average daytime highs of 31°C and overnight lows near 20°C, with 0 mm of rain across 0.1 wet days and about 11.3 hours of daylight. It is the 6th-warmest and 6th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s ease over the month, from about 33°C in the first days to 29°C by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 91% of the time in October, and the air most often feels comfortable.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 42 min at the start of October to 10 h 54 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, October is Al ‘Idwah's 5th-clearest and 7th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Al ‘Idwah's year-round climate.

Temperature in October

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Highs ease over the month, from about 33°C in the first days to 29°C by the end.

A typical October day in Al ‘Idwah reaches about 31°C in the afternoon and slips back to 20°C overnight — a 11°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 28°C and 35°C. Set against its neighbours, October runs about 4°C cooler than September and about 5°C warmer than November.

Sunrise & sunset in October

DaylightNight

Daylight runs from about 11 h 42 min at the start of October to 10 h 54 min by month's end. The lit band spans sunrise to sunset each day.

Days shrink by about 48 minutes over October. Sunrise moves from 5:54 AM to 6:13 AM, and sunset from 5:38 PM to 5:08 PM.

UV index in Al ‘Idwah in October

LowModerateHighVery highExtreme

Clear-sky midday UV in October peaks around 7 — enough to warrant sun protection. The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.

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Al ‘Idwah peaks around July 17 at about 11 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near January 13 at about 4 (moderate).

The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.

Air quality in Al ‘Idwah in October

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where October fal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Al ‘Idwah is worst in January — around 82 µg/m³ PM2.5 (unhealthy), about 2.4× the cleanest month (July, 34 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Al ‘Idwah?

Al ‘Idwah sits at 28.7°N, 30.8°E, 33 m above sea level, in Egypt. The nearest listed city is Maghāghah, 9.0 km away.

Topography around Al ‘Idwah

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Al ‘Idwah.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Al ‘Idwah has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 11 m around an average of 32 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 211 m; within 80 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 463 m.

The land around Al ‘Idwah is covered by cropland (80%) within 3 km, cropland (67%) within 16 km, and bare terrain (75%) and cropland (20%) within 80 km.
